"What if Armenians successfully revolted against the Ottoman Empire in 1893?"

Returning to Ararat sees a new world born out of constant war, death and revolution. By 1936, it has been 40 years since the Ottoman Empire collapsed and was dismanteled, but unknowingly the collapse would be the catalyst for various events that unfolded later on.
The Great War changed everything, ruining Europe, paving the way for socialism to spread like wildfire, from Paris to Moscow. The world proved inadequate with dealing with these social changes, and one by one, Russia, Germany, Britain, America, China and France all tore each other apart. Now, as the new year dawns over Europe, a new Great War is looming, but this time it will be fought over ideology, not imperialism or nationalism. These next few years will prove vital to the major nations of the world, whether the world is tiped in their favor or not.
Content:
Customized content (focus trees, events etc.) for the German Union, Iran, Turkey, White and Red Russia, Peoples’ Union of America, Legion of America, the Southern Union, Chinese Mountain Rebels, Republic of Canada and the Federation of Hayastan.
What will come next? In the future, the team hopes to fully customize and give content to every major nation, from France to Argentina.
